Crystal structure of the binary complex between HLA-A2 and HCMV NLV-T8A peptide variant
X-RAY DIFFRACTION
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details | 
| 1 | VAPOR DIFFUSION, HANGING DROP | 6.5 | 293 | 9-20% PEG 6000, 0.1M tri-Na Citrate, 0-0.1M NaCl, pH 6.5, vapor diffusion, hanging drop, temperature 293K |
